Radio Advertising  Australia

Radio advertising is a great way to reach a large audience in a cost-effective way. According to the Commercial Radio Australia, around 10.7 million people in Australia listen to commercial radio each week. This makes radio advertising an excellent way to get your message out to a large number of people.

The cost of radio advertising in Australia varies depending on a range of factors, including the station, time of day, and length of the ad. On average, a 30-second ad on a metropolitan radio station during peak listening hours can cost between $300 and $1000. Regional stations are generally cheaper, with prices ranging from $50 to $500 per 30-second ad.

TV Advertising  Australia

TV advertising is one of the most effective ways to reach a large audience in Australia. According to the TV ratings company OzTAM, around 89% of Australians watch TV every week. This makes TV advertising a great way to get your message out to a wide range of people.

The cost of TV advertising in Australia varies depending on a range of factors, including the network, program, and time of day. On average, a 30-second ad on a national free-to-air network during prime time can cost between $10,000 and $100,000. Regional networks are generally cheaper, with prices ranging from $500 to $10,000 per 30-second ad.

When it comes to comparing the costs of radio and TV advertising in Australia, there are a few things to consider. While TV advertising is generally more expensive than radio advertising, it also offers a wider reach and the ability to target specific demographics. Radio advertising, on the other hand, is more cost-effective and can be a great way to reach a local audience.

Ultimately, the choice between radio and TV advertising will depend on your business's specific goals and budget. If you're looking to reach a wide audience with a high-quality ad, TV advertising may be the way to go. If you're on a tight budget but still want to get your message out to a local audience, radio advertising may be a better fit.
